Electrotonus
Pronunciation : E`lec*trot"o*nus
Part of Speech : n.
Etymology : [NL., fr. combining form electro- + Gr. (Physiol.)
Definition : Defn: The modified condition of a nerve, when a constant current of electricity passes through any part of it. See Anelectrotonus, and Catelectrotonus.
